Honestly speaking plastic glasses look bright and beautiful. A few years back plastic frames wherein as in people would prefer to buy it. Manufacturers preferred to make plastic glasses. This is because plastic glasses are light in weight, easy to carry, and less expensive. Now the story has changed completely.
Eyewear brands do not like to make plastic frames as because it is sensitive to the skin. It also turns and twists easily. Inexpensive plastic frames or glasses do get scratch more easily. Sometimes harsh weather conditions erode plastics glasses.
